3.) Dress Comfortably.

Besides dressing nicely for your photo shoot you need to make sure you’re 100% comfortable in what you’re wearing. If you wear flats often, like myself, don’t wear 6 inch heels for your photo session. The last thing to be is in pain when you’re getting photos done! Make sure whatever you wear for your session you feel comfortable and confident! Make sure your spouse to be feels comfortable as well! As a couple you should feel your best for your session and clothes help make the man/woman!

5.) Include hobbies, special items, and places.

If you and your fiance love football, art, theater, or even wine tasting include it in your session! There is nothing I love more when couples include special things about themselves within their sessions! For example, one couple I photographed are big into theater so they decided to get their photos done at the embassy theater downtown! Another thing to keep in mind are special locations: where you first met, where you had your first date, or a place you just love to be together whether that be at the lake or in your home location, hobbies, and items like this are SO SO important!
